モネロ【XMR】の匿名性テクノロジーを徹底検証



モネロ【XMR】の匿名性テクノロジーを徹底検証


モネロ【XMR】の匿名性テクノロジーを徹底検証

モネロ(Monero、XMR)は、プライバシー保護に重点を置いた暗号資産であり、その匿名性は他の暗号資産と比較して格段に高いと評価されています。本稿では、モネロの匿名性を支える主要なテクノロジーを詳細に検証し、その仕組み、利点、そして潜在的な課題について深く掘り下げていきます。

1. モネロの匿名性の重要性

暗号資産の普及において、プライバシーは重要な要素の一つです。取引履歴が公開されているビットコインなどの暗号資産では、ブロックチェーン分析によって個人の取引が特定されるリスクが存在します。モネロは、このようなプライバシー上の懸念を解消するために設計されており、取引の送信者、受信者、そして取引額を隠蔽することを目的としています。これは、金融の自由、個人のプライバシー保護、そして検閲耐性といった価値を実現するために不可欠です。

2. モネロの匿名性テクノロジーの概要

モネロの匿名性は、以下の主要なテクノロジーによって実現されています。

  • リング署名(Ring Signatures)
  • ステルスアドレス(Stealth Addresses)
  • RingCT(Ring Confidential Transactions)
  • Dandelion++

これらのテクノロジーは、単独で機能するだけでなく、互いに連携することで、より強固な匿名性を実現しています。

3. リング署名(Ring Signatures)の詳細

リング署名は、複数の署名者のうち、誰が実際に署名したかを特定できない署名方式です。モネロでは、取引の送信者が自身の公開鍵だけでなく、ブロックチェーンからランダムに選択された他のユーザーの公開鍵も署名に含めます。これにより、取引の送信者を特定することが非常に困難になります。リングのサイズが大きいほど、匿名性は高まります。モネロでは、リングサイズはデフォルトで5つに設定されていますが、ユーザーはより大きなリングサイズを選択することも可能です。

リング署名の仕組みは、数学的な複雑さを利用しており、署名者の特定を試みる攻撃者にとって計算コストが非常に高くなります。これにより、実用的な時間内に署名者を特定することはほぼ不可能となります。

4. ステルスアドレス(Stealth Addresses)の詳細

ステルスアドレスは、受信者の公開鍵を直接公開することなく、取引ごとに新しいアドレスを生成する技術です。モネロでは、送信者は受信者の公開鍵からワンタイムアドレスを生成し、そのアドレスに資金を送信します。これにより、受信者のアドレスが繰り返し使用されることを防ぎ、取引履歴の追跡を困難にします。ステルスアドレスは、受信者のプライバシーを保護する上で非常に重要な役割を果たします。

ステルスアドレスの生成には、暗号学的なハッシュ関数が使用されており、ワンタイムアドレスは予測不可能で、一度しか使用されません。これにより、アドレスの再利用によるプライバシー侵害のリスクを最小限に抑えることができます。

5. RingCT(Ring Confidential Transactions)の詳細

RingCTは、取引額を隠蔽する技術です。従来の暗号資産では、取引額がブロックチェーン上に公開されているため、取引の分析によって個人の経済状況が推測される可能性があります。RingCTは、リング署名の技術を応用して、取引額を暗号化し、ブロックチェーン上に公開される情報を最小限に抑えます。これにより、取引額が誰によって支払われたか、そして誰に支払われたかを隠蔽することができます。

RingCTは、取引額の合計がリング内の他の取引額と一致することを確認することで、取引の正当性を検証します。これにより、取引額が不正に改ざんされることを防ぎながら、プライバシーを保護することができます。

6. Dandelion++の詳細

Dandelion++は、取引の送信者のIPアドレスを隠蔽する技術です。従来の暗号資産では、取引がネットワークにブロードキャストされる際に、送信者のIPアドレスが公開される可能性があります。Dandelion++は、取引を複数のノードを経由して拡散させることで、送信者のIPアドレスを隠蔽します。これにより、送信者の位置情報を特定することを困難にします。

Dandelion++は、取引をランダムなノードに転送するプロセスを繰り返すことで、送信者のIPアドレスと取引の関連性を曖昧にします。これにより、攻撃者が送信者のIPアドレスを特定することを非常に困難にします。

7. モネロの匿名性の課題と今後の展望

モネロの匿名性は非常に高いレベルにありますが、完全に匿名であるわけではありません。例えば、取引のタイミングや金額によっては、ブロックチェーン分析によって取引を関連付けることが可能な場合があります。また、モネロのネットワークは、他の暗号資産と比較して規模が小さいため、51%攻撃のリスクも存在します。

モネロの開発チームは、これらの課題を認識しており、匿名性をさらに向上させるための研究開発を継続的に行っています。例えば、BulletproofsやSchnorr署名などの新しいテクノロジーの導入が検討されています。これらのテクノロジーは、取引のサイズを削減し、プライバシーをさらに強化することが期待されています。

また、モネロのコミュニティは、プライバシー保護に関する意識を高め、ユーザーが安全にモネロを使用するための教育活動にも力を入れています。これにより、モネロの匿名性を最大限に活用し、プライバシーを保護することができます。

8. モネロと他の匿名性暗号資産との比較

モネロ以外にも、プライバシー保護に重点を置いた暗号資産は存在します。例えば、Zcash(ZEC)は、zk-SNARKsと呼ばれるゼロ知識証明技術を使用して、取引の送信者、受信者、そして取引額を隠蔽します。Dashは、PrivateSendと呼ばれる技術を使用して、複数のユーザーの取引を混合することで、匿名性を高めます。

モネロは、これらの暗号資産と比較して、デフォルトで匿名性が有効になっているという点が特徴です。Zcashでは、プライバシー保護された取引を使用するには、特別な設定が必要ですが、モネロでは、すべての取引がデフォルトで匿名化されます。また、モネロは、より分散化された開発体制を採用しており、コミュニティの貢献度が高いという特徴もあります。

9. まとめ

モネロは、リング署名、ステルスアドレス、RingCT、Dandelion++といった高度な匿名性テクノロジーを組み合わせることで、他の暗号資産と比較して格段に高い匿名性を実現しています。これらのテクノロジーは、取引の送信者、受信者、そして取引額を隠蔽し、プライバシーを保護します。モネロは、金融の自由、個人のプライバシー保護、そして検閲耐性といった価値を実現するための重要なツールとなり得ます。しかし、完全に匿名であるわけではなく、課題も存在するため、今後の技術開発とコミュニティの努力によって、さらなる匿名性の向上が期待されます。モネロは、プライバシーを重視するユーザーにとって、非常に魅力的な選択肢と言えるでしょう。


前の記事

スカイ(SKY)と巡る空の伝説と神秘の世界

次の記事

テゾス(XTZ)でできる最新の分散型アプリ